At a restaurant, four people ordered fried crab cakes and four people ordered a cup of gumbo, with a total of $31. If only two p
ruslelena [56]

Answer:

Fried crab cakes = $4.50

Cup of gumbo = $3.25

Step-by-step explanation:

Let's make the price of fried crab cakes = x and the price of a cup of gumbo = y. Set up two equations for x and y and solve for each variable.

<h3><u>Setting up the equations:</u></h3>

4 people ordered x and 4 people ordered y for a total of 31 dollars, so this equation would look like: 4x + 4y = 31

2 people ordered x and 1 person ordered y for a total of $12.25, so this equation would look like: 2x + y = 12.25

<h3><u>Substitution method:</u></h3>

Now you have your two equations-- solve for a variable in one of the equations and substitute that value into the other equation.

The easiest way to start would be to solve for y in the second equation by subtracting 2x from both sides.

y = 12.25 - 2x

Substitute this value into the first equation.

4x + 4(12.25 - 2x) = 31

Now solve for x-- start by distributing 4 inside the parentheses.

4x + (49 - 8x) = 31

Combine like terms.

-4x + 49 = 31

Subtract 49 from both sides.

-4x = -18

Divide both sides by -4.

x = 4.5

Substitute this value of x into our starting equation for which we solved for y.

2(4.5) + y = 12.25

Multiply 2 and 4.5 together.

9 + y = 12.25

Subtract 9 from both sides.

y = 3.25

Each order of fried crab cakes is worth the x-value [$4.50] and each cup of gumbo is worth the y-value [$3.25].
